Feed the Mass Launches FEDRx: Innovative Program Addressing Health-Related Social Needs Through Nutrition
PORTLAND, OR – Feed the Mass is proud to announce the official launch of FED Rx, a groundbreaking initiative designed to address Health-Related Social Needs (HRSN) by providing culturally specific meals, housing support, and wellness services to those facing food insecurity and housing instability in Portland, with a special focus on nourishing 10,000 mothers over the next five years.
In partnership with the Oregon Health Authority (OHA) and Coordinated Care Organizations across the region, FEDRx delivers culturally-specific, medically tailored meals to eligible participants, particularly mothers during pregnancy, postpartum recovery, and chronic illness, while connecting them with critical housing support and wellness resources.
"As we expand our mission, FED Rx represents a pivotal step in our commitment to holistic community support,” said Jacob Valentine, Founder of Feed the Mass. “We’re not just serving meals—we’re addressing the systemic challenges that impact food security, housing stability, and overall health.”
To qualify for FEDRx housing and food services, individuals must be enrolled in the Oregon Health Plan (OHP) and meet at least one vulnerability criterion: risk of homelessness or housing instability; managing a complex health condition; pregnancy or caring for a child under 6; transitioning from incarceration, foster care, or a care facility; or having a household income at or below 30% of the area median income.

About Feed the Mass:
Founded in 2016, Feed the Mass is a Portland-based nonprofit dedicated to empowering, educating, and serving the community through food. With a focus on fighting food insecurity and promoting nutritional education, Feed the Mass has provided over 500,000 meals to those in need.
